Output e8425e2b32b6e23f79cf29f0e6837faae740101ec18ca9ad261ccdfa53cba1b9:2

value
3770539
script pubkey
OP_0 OP_PUSHBYTES_20 daf8428403e7288088cada2af7017539b0fdeb30
address
ltc1qmtuy9pqruu5gpzx2mg40wqt48xc0m6esdl5jm0
transaction
e8425e2b32b6e23f79cf29f0e6837faae740101ec18ca9ad261ccdfa53cba1b9
spent
true